2009 is when the Gen4s were stopped and Gen5s started, but I don't think they made a Gen 5 R - so I assume yours is a Gen4?
Almost all Gen4s use the C1 disc, except for the very very latest (which yours is). I believe the Rs were the only cars that had DVD Movie playing capability, so the headunit is different. If your Nav Disc location is the same as other SpecBs, then it's just in the remote drive in the glovebox. Or if it's like Gen5s, then it's hidden under a flap on the main headunit.
